Benjamin Kramer 
							
						 
					 
					
						
						
							
						
						f012705c7e 
					 
					
						
						
							
							Avoid going through the LLVMContext for type equality where it's safe to dereference the type pointer.  
						
						... 
						
						
						
						git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@92726  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2010-01-05 13:12:22 +00:00 
						 
				 
			
				
					
						
							
							
								Dan Gohman 
							
						 
					 
					
						
						
							
						
						5fca8b1c8d 
					 
					
						
						
							
							Move CopyCatchInfo into FunctionLoweringInfo.cpp too, for consistency.  
						
						... 
						
						
						
						git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@89683  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2009-11-23 18:12:11 +00:00 
						 
				 
			
				
					
						
							
							
								Dan Gohman 
							
						 
					 
					
						
						
							
						
						66336edf82 
					 
					
						
						
							
							Move some more code out of SelectionDAGBuild.cpp and into  
						
						... 
						
						
						
						FunctionLoweringInfo.cpp.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@89674  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2009-11-23 17:42:46 +00:00 
						 
				 
			
				
					
						
							
							
								Dan Gohman 
							
						 
					 
					
						
						
							
						
						6277eb2bb9 
					 
					
						
						
							
							Move the FunctionLoweringInfo class and some related utility functions out  
						
						... 
						
						
						
						of SelectionDAGBuild.h/cpp into its own files, to help separate
general lowering logic from SelectionDAG-specific lowering logic.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@89667  91177308-0d34-0410-b5e6-96231b3b80d8 
						
						
					 
					
						2009-11-23 17:16:22 +00:00